How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Education from Muskingum Cost?

$29,490 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Muskingum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Muskingum paid an average of $640 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$28,700$28,700
Fees$790$790
Books and Supplies$1,100$1,100
On Campus Room and Board$11,860$11,860
On Campus Other Expenses$1,722$1,722

Does Muskingum Offer an Online Bachelor’s in Education?

Muskingum does not offer an online option for its education bachelor’s degree program at this time. To see if the school offers distance learning options in other areas, visit the Muskingum Online Learning page.

Muskingum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Education

24 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
75.0% Women
8.3%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
In the 2019-2020 academic year, 24 students received their bachelor’s degree in education.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

About 75.0% of the students who received their Bachelor’s in education in 2019-2020 were women. This is less than the nationwide number of 81.9%.

undefined

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Of those graduates who received a bachelor’s degree in education at Muskingum in 2019-2020, 8.3% were racial-ethnic minorities*. This is lower than the nationwide number of 25%.

Bachelor’s in Education Focus Areas at Muskingum

Education students may decide to major in one of the following focus areas.

Focus AreaAnnual Graduates
Special Education2
Teacher Education Grade Specific17
Teacher Education Subject Specific5
